Bug Description

Use the manual partitioner option and go all the way to the final confirmation screen. Then start going back until you reach "Prepare partition". Going back to this screen for some reason restarts gparted. Once you close gparted, both the forward button and the back button cease to work.

Michael Vogt (mvo) wrote :

I ran into a similar problem, gparted was started outside the espresso window (as a seperate window) and espresso hung until I closed gparted. Going forward again resulted in a crash. I'll attach the installer log.

Colin Watson (cjwatson) wrote :

I fixed Michael's bug recently:

ubiquity (0.99.80) dapper; urgency=low

  * If we get an IOError when trying to tell gparted or qtparted to apply
    changes, just shut it down and try running it again (closes: Malone
    #43504, #44108).
  * Fix get_string to handle requests for fully-qualified debconf questions
    again.
  * Defend against progress_title being None in debconf_progress_start a bit
    harder.
  * Update Korean translation from Rosetta.

 -- Colin Watson <email address hidden> Fri, 12 May 2006 18:56:36 +0100

I suspect this and other recent changes will have sorted out this bug. If you can still reproduce it in the release candidate (not Ubuntu/amd64, since we had to ship an older version of that due to a different bug, but any other architecture) then please reopen this bug.
